Output e427943a338f63309e91a48809cdd28164f15a2d0dd871a10566d3a34a7a96ac:1

value
70000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11d6015a00fbc8129a46c8f847dec984bb266c57 OP_EQUALVERIFY OP_CHECKSIG
address
12dJrcJQErhdQDmaLJMsLr73vXaE6jCysj
transaction
e427943a338f63309e91a48809cdd28164f15a2d0dd871a10566d3a34a7a96ac
spent
true